damside

English

Etymology

From dam + side.

Noun

damside

  1. The side or bank of a dam.
    • 1999, JM Coetzee, Disgrace, Vintage 2000, p. 123:
      Exasperated, he unties them and tugs them over to the damside, where there is abundant grass.
